Scope of the Patent
The scope of JP2011079859 is primarily defined by its claims, which delineate the legal boundaries of the invention. Patent claims are structured into independent and dependent types, with the independent claims establishing the broadest coverage.

Dependent Claims
Dependent claims add specificity, possibly including:
-
Variations in chemical structure (substituents, stereochemistry).
-
Specific formulations (e.g., capsules, injections).
-
Process claims involving preparation steps.
-
Additional therapeutic indications or combination therapies.
By introducing these nuances, the patent fortifies its protection against design-arounds and niche competitors.

Patent Filings & Priority Data
The filing date (may be the priority date if a PCT application) is crucial for assessing patent term and infringement timelines. The patent's expiration, typically 20 years from filing, influences market exclusivity.
